Abruzzo Italian Kitchen opened in December 2017. As is the Italian tradition, our focus is on the quality of our ingredients and simplicity of preparation. We cook by hand, from scratch, including all of our fresh pastas and wood fired pizzas. In addition to the Italian staples, we offer an extensive shared plates selection, grilled steaks, fresh seafood, and a small but decadent dessert list, all prepared in-house and served alongside an Italian-focused cocktail program and an Italian-centric wine list. Hospitality is the core of what we do: our staff is warm, genuine, knowledgeable, and attentive, and we pride ourselves on creating memorable experiences for every guest that walks through our doors.

    Herb and Omni is a modern jewel box: slim walnut lines, pale fabrics, a few artful blooms. Chairs are soft enough that you won’t mind the bill arriving late. The staff run the room with calm precision. Water never dips, plates appear in step with conversation, and every question—about sourcing, preparation —gets an unscripted answer. Suggestions feel personal, and the pacing borders on clairvoyant. The wine list is capable but cautious—tidy pinots, polite chardonnays, a safe Bordeaux. A few skin-contact whites or funky oranges would add excitement, yet we were able to find something to suit our tastes with ease. Food opens strong. Carrots in crunchy dukkah balance sweetness and spice; tempura enoki mushrooms crackle, then vanish. A caviar interlude—sleek roe on cool crème fraîche—adds a flash of luxury without grandstanding. Two entrées carry the night: Pan-roasted duck breast sits rosy and crisp amid cherry mole, maque choux, confit maitake, pickled ramps, and foie-gras jus. Each garnish lifts the duck without drowning it. Crispy leek dumplings float in green-curry broth with bok choy, turnip, and black-garlic XO; tofu cream calms the heat while shiso brightens every bite. Cocktails keep pace. The Punchline—clarified strawberry-banana tequila, banana liqueur, lime—plays bright fruit against a dry finish. Secondhand marries tequila, passion-fruit shrub, yuzu-vanilla cordial, orange-blossom water, and a trickle of IPA for a floral, lightly bitter refresher. Both arrive cold and confident. We came for my partner’s birthday, and the staff slipped a handwritten card signed by the entire team —a gesture she’ll remember far longer than any foie-gras jus. We left full, impressed, and, above all, cared for. The kitchen sends out beautiful plates; the front-of-house turns them into an occasion... proof that hospitality still matters most.
